Case summary

The player from Australia had used her partner's card for multiple deposits, and upon winning $2800, the casino had refused to allow the withdrawal, citing that they didn't accept third-party payments. The player had voiced frustration as the casino continued to accept the deposits. We had reviewed the casino's terms and conditions and found that the use of third-party payments was indeed prohibited. We had informed the player about this rule, but she did not respond to our messages. Therefore, we were unable to investigate further and had to reject the complaint.

Thank you very much for submitting your complaint. I’m sorry to hear about your problem. I have checked the terms and conditions of the casino, and this is what I found https://luckyelfcasino.com/terms-and-conditions:

"Using third party payments is prohibited . You must make deposits only from a bank account, bank cards, e-wallets or other payment methods that are registered in your own name. If we determine during the security checks that you have violated this condition, your winnings will be confiscated and the original deposit will be returned to the owner of the payment account. The Company is not responsible for the lost funds deposited from third party accounts."

 

Furthermore, please check our Fair Gambling Codex for Players https://casino.guru/fair-gambling-codex-for-players:

"Payments
For deposits and withdrawals, you should only use bank accounts and credit cards held in your own name. If you don't do this, you might get into trouble when trying to make a withdrawal. This rule is mostly in place to prevent credit card misuse and also because of international anti-money-laundering regulations."

 

Please understand that this rule has been breached. Some exceptions might be allowed by casinos when depositing or withdrawing funds using a joint card or this possibility is communicated beforehand. Technically it is very difficult to check who’s the owner of the payment method at the depositing stage. This can be checked only during the account verification, which is usually done when a withdrawal is requested. Therefore, it is a player’s responsibility to use allowed payment methods only.

If you’re not able to prove that you are a legitimate owner of the payment method and you haven’t received approval from the casino allowing you to use a third-party payment method, I’m afraid there’s not much we can do for you.
